JD Vance reportedly mocks Carney for trying to ‘out-tough’ Trump on trade
Audio recording of US vice-president apparently made at New York fundraiser and shared with Canadian Press
Leaked audio from a private event has reportedly captured the US vice-president, JD Vance, mocking Canada for apparently capitulating in a trade deal and taunting the prime minister, Mark Carney, for trying to “out-tough” Donald Trump.
The recording, which was reportedly made at a fundraiser and shared with the Canadian Press, comes in the last stretch of a difficult negotiation in which the US president has threatened to impose 50% tariffs on Canada.
